Description

Vogue Knitting: The Ultimate Knitting Book positions itself not merely as an instruction manual, but as the canonical technical reference for the craft. It begins with a concise history of knitting, establishing its cultural lineage, before methodically cataloging the essential tools and materials. The core philosophy is one of comprehensiveness and choice, presenting multiple validated methods for every fundamental action—from casting on to binding off, increasing to decreasing—empowering the knitter to select the technique best suited to the project's aesthetic and functional demands. Its pedagogical strength lies in the seamless integration of detailed illustrations, step-by-step photographs, and clear textual instructions. This multi-modal approach clarifies everything from basic knit and purl stitches to advanced colorwork, cabling, and lace. A significant portion of the book is devoted to the often-overlooked art of finishing: blocking, seaming, creating buttonholes and pockets, and adding linings. The substantial stitch dictionary provides a visual catalog of textures, while the design section offers a mathematical framework for constructing sweaters, complete with worksheets for custom measurements and shaping. The book concludes with a selection of modular and traditional garment patterns, serving as practical applications of the preceding lessons. Its target audience is the serious knitter—whether a dedicated beginner or an experienced practitioner seeking to fill gaps in their knowledge. It functions less as a linear tutorial and more as a permanent, authoritative desk reference, aiming to be the single volume a knitter reaches for when a question of technique arises. Its legacy is that of a technical bible, a trusted source that demystifies the mechanics behind beautiful, durable knitted fabric.

Community Verdict

The knitting community regards this volume as an indispensable, if flawed, cornerstone of the craft library. Its unparalleled breadth and the clarity of its visual instructions are universally praised, with many declaring it the single most comprehensive reference they own. The detailed photographs and diagrams for techniques like finishing and error correction are consistently highlighted as transformative, turning frustrating hurdles into manageable steps. However, a significant and vocal critique centers on its organizational architecture and occasional technical oversights. The indexing system is widely condemned as inadequate, making specific information difficult to locate swiftly. Furthermore, the book’s ambitious title sets a high bar it does not fully meet; notable omissions include in-depth coverage of circular knitting, socks, hats, and modern methods like the magic loop. The advanced design section and stitch dictionary, while valuable, are reported to contain confusing instructions and typos that can undermine confidence. The consensus is that this is a brilliant supporting reference for knitters with some foundational experience, but it should not be expected to stand alone as a truly "ultimate" guide to every knitting discipline.
